Pig Dice: a Very Simple Jeopardy Game for iOS

Posted on Tuesday 29 January 2013

In this podcast, John Courtney gives us a demonstration of Pig Dice, a very simple jeopardy game in which two players race to reach 100 points. Each turn, a player repeatedly rolls a die until either a 1 is rolled or the player holds and scores the sum of the rolls (that is, the turn total). Your objective is simply, try to avoid making your iDevice go "Oink!".

Pig Dice is available for free from the iTunes App Store.

BlindSide: Has Stumbling Around in the Dark Ever Been this Much Fun?

Posted on Tuesday 15 January 2013

Stumbling around in the dark has never been as much fun or as scary, as this.

In this podcast, Khalfan Bin Dhaher introduces us to the gaming experience of BlindSide, an iOS app that throws you into a fully immersive 3D audio adventure set in a world you'll never see.

Learn how to play this wonderful game and listen as the world rotates and you explore the darkness. Learn how to navigate by tilting your device or rotating your body.

VoiceOver should be turned off whilst playing, and you will also need to use headphones.
